2. Creating a Strong Brand Identity
Visual 2: Brand Identity Components Infographic
This infographic presents the core elements of a brand identity, including logo, color scheme, typography, and messaging.
- Key Elements:
- Logo: A memorable logo that reflects your business.
- Color Scheme: Consistent colors that convey your brand's emotions.
- Typography: Fonts that match your brand personality.
3. Developing a Content Strategy
Visual 3: Content Calendar Sample
This sample content calendar outlines a month-long plan for posting on social media.
- Content Types:
- Educational Posts: Share tips and industry insights.
- Promotional Content: Announce sales, products, or services.
- Engaging Content: Use polls, questions, or user-generated content to foster community.
